Abstract

PROBLEM TO BE SOLVED: To prevent the temperature in a pair of shoes from rising due to the heat of feet and inhibit the feet from getting sweaty by forcibly taking air into the shoes from the outside during waking with the shoes and circulating the air within the shoes. SOLUTION: Soles are provided with a air bag (3) having an air valve (1), an air valve (2), and a tube (4) penetrating into the shoes. Consequently, the air outside the shoes can be forcibly taken into the shoes by using compression and restoration of the air bag (3) during walking.

According to the present invention, an air bag (3) provided with an air valve (1), an air valve (2) and a tube (4) is attached to the sole of a shoe, and the weight of the person is reduced by walking. The bladder is compressed, and the air in the compressed bladder is forced out through the tube (4) and into the shoe. When the compressed air bladder (3) loses its weight due to walking, the air bladder (3) is restored to its original size. At this time, air outside the shoe is taken into the air bag (3) from the air valve (2), and the air bag (3) is restored. As the air bag (3) is compressed and decompressed by walking, air circulates from the outside of the shoe to the inside of the shoe, from the inside of the shoe to the outside of the shoe, and the air outside the shoe is taken into the shoe. An air-intake shoe that prevents the temperature inside the shoe from rising and prevents the feet from becoming uneven.
